Brick-Built Wonders: Pokemon Fan Showcases LEGO Koraidon and Scream Tail

Online acclaim for an imaginative Pokemon enthusiast’s stunning LEGO renditions of Koraidon and Scream Tail from the latest Paradox Pokemon series.

Online buzz surrounds a talented Pokemon aficionado who has captivated audiences with their remarkable LEGO interpretations of Koraidon and Scream Tail. These intricately designed creations, featured in both regular and shiny forms, have earned substantial praise online, amassing hundreds of likes and commendations from enthusiasts.

Hailing from the newest addition to the Pokemon franchise, Generation 9’s Pokemon Scarlet and Violet, the Paradox Pokemon category introduces unique futuristic and ancient iterations of well-known Pokemon. Koraidon and Scream Tail, belonging to the ancient Paradox Pokemon group exclusively found in Pokemon Scarlet, are just two among the fascinating array of these distinctive creatures. With 18 Paradox Pokemon currently introduced across the games, anticipation builds for additional releases, teased in the leaked Indigo Disk DLC for Pokemon Scarlet and Violet.

The impressive LEGO renditions emerged on Reddit, shared by user zombieee4567, showcasing remarkable attention to detail and craftsmanship. Each creation meticulously captures the essence of the respective Pokemon, with particular acclaim for the meticulous portrayal of Koraidon’s intricacies in the first and third slides and Scream Tail’s unexpected competitive pose in the second and fourth.

The Pokemon community has responded with overwhelming praise, acknowledging the artist’s previous LEGO Paradox Pokemon creations, such as Iron Bundle, Iron Valiant, Sandy Shocks, and Flutter Mane, inspired by Delibird, Gardevoir/Gallade, Magneton, and Misdreavus. These exhibits showcase the artist’s consistent ability to encapsulate the essence of Paradox Pokemon through LEGO.

In the wider Pokemon fandom, other enthusiasts have also displayed their creativity by crafting various Pokemon models, including Eevee and its evolutions, using LEGO. While not as intricate as the LEGO Koraidon and Scream Tail, these creations exhibit the boundless creativity prevalent within the Pokemon community, continually producing impressive displays of affection for their beloved franchise.
